Additionally, weight may be a factor. Significant improvements can result from even a small weight loss. It can not only lessen snoring, but it also frequently increases energy and the quality of sleep. The likelihood of airway obstruction during sleep is increased when one is overweight, especially around the neck and upper body. Making minor changes like walking more or eating healthier can gradually produce results; this doesn’t require extreme dieting or strenuous exercise.

Louder nights are the result of alcohol and heavy meals right before bed relaxing the muscles in your throat more than normal.
You can maintain stability by eating dinner a few hours earlier and replacing that late-night glass of wine with a soothing chamomile tea. You may also need to make adjustments to your evening routine.
